Bloggers Needed For 2,996 Project..

by Conservative Pup on August 4, 2009

“Project 2,996 is a tribute to the victims of 9/11.

On September 11, 2006, more than 3000 bloggers joined together to remember the victims of 9/11.”

I just learned about this, thanks to Michelle Malkin.  I’ve signed up and hope you will too.  The 2,996 Project is all about honoring and paying tribute to the victims.  As the project website says, there’s been more written and spoken about the murderers of that day, than those they killed, and this project’s desire is to speak not of those who murdered, but to tell the story, to honor the life of someone whose life was taken that day.
